Direct Liverpool to Llandudno train runs through summer holidays
Direct Liverpool-Llandudno train runs this summer

The direct Transport for Wales (TfW) service between Liverpool and Llandudno is still running over the summer holidays. Timetable changes reported on Sunday, May 17 now include the direct link, putting the seaside town less than two hours away and giving families without a car a new option for trips to the coast. The route takes in budget-friendly North Wales seaside towns that have been popular with generations of families from Merseyside.

Seaside stops along the route

Llandudno is home to the Great Orme, a limestone headland rising 200 metres above the sea. Visitors can walk to the top or use the Great Orme Tramway for views over the town. The resort has twin West and North Shore beaches, with West Shore Beach much quieter than the North Shore. Llandudno Pier, the longest pier in Wales, was originally built in 1876 and offers ice cream, arcades and family fun.

Prestatyn is known for its beaches, promenade and holiday camps loved by many Scouse families. A key draw on the beachfront is the Nova, one of North Wales' biggest indoor visitor attractions, featuring a three-storey, beach-themed indoor adventure soft play centre and a Beach Hut Café and Bar with views of the Prestatyn coast.

Rhyl is undergoing a £20m regeneration project to enhance the seaside resort, driven by Rhyl Neighbourhood Board and the Ein Rhyl/Our Rhyl campaign. One of the town's most recent additions is the Queen's Market, which opened on July 10, 2025. The food hall and market cost over £12m and include 16 individual food and retail units, a bar and a large event space.

Stops on the Liverpool to Llandudno service

The full list of stations on the route is:

  • Liverpool Lime Street
  • Liverpool South Parkway
  • Runcorn
  • Frodsham
  • Helsby
  • Chester
  • Shotton
  • Flint
  • Prestatyn
  • Rhyl
  • Abergele & Pensarn
  • Colwyn Bay
  • Llandudno Junction
  • Deganwy
  • Llandudno
